Oyo: Guber Polls Situation Report

The visible presence of security operatives in most past of Ibadan, Oyo State capital contributed immensely to the peaceful conduct of the polls in most of the poling units across the state.

As early as 7 o’clock in the morning, prospective voters were seen converging at the polling centres for accreditation which commenced in earnest in most units visited by our correspondent.

At Ward 3, Unit 22 in the Oke Aremo, Ibadan North Local Government Area, the turnout of voters was more impressive than what obtained during the March 28 Presidential election.

Barrister Sharafadeen Abiodun Alli, Deputy Governorship candidate of Labour Party in the state hailed the performance of INEC in the accreditation noting that the Card Readers performed better this time around.

Man nabbed with Fake PVC

A middle-aged man was arrested by security operatives with fake Permanent Voters Register (PVC) at Oju Irin Ward 4, Bodija, in the Ibadan North Local Government area. 

The suspect was instantly taken to the nearby police station for further interrogation.

Joint Military, Police Surveillance at Iwo Road, Mapo, Beere other flash points of Ibadan

The military and police personnel effected water-tight security at some flash points of Ibadan notably Iwo Road, Mapo, Beere, Molete and other areas.

They carried out bodily and vehicular search on people apparently with a view to averting unnecessary crisis.

A notable politician at the Mapo axis of Ibadan and Oyo State Coordinator of SURE-P, Mr. Dare Adeleke acknowledged the improved security arrangement as well as the “better accreditation processes” submitting that with the better awareness shown by the electorate, the future is brighter for democracy in Nigeria.

Seyi Makinde predicts a re-run Guber Election

The Governorship candidate of the Social Democratic Party (SDP) in Oyo State, Engr. Seyi Makinde scored the INEC’s accreditation processes better than what obtained at the Presidential poll, but submitted that the Governorship election in the state may result in a re-run.

Makinde told newsmen that he did not see whoever is winning Saturday’s Guber poll meeting the constitutional requirement of 25 per cent in 23 Local Governments of the state.

“In case of re-run, I see SDP emerging the winner,” Seyi MaKINDE SAID.

People are now more vigilant –  Ladoja

Governorship candidate of Accord Party, Senator Rashidi Ladoja, who performed his franchise at Ward 10, Unit 13, Ondo Street, Bodija, Ibadan polling centre commended the electorate for being security conscious.

He said:  “I can say that people are now more vigilant.  They are now more vigilant because last time, they found out that in many places, voters were more than the accredited voters.  How did it happen?  Now that they see that votes were tampered with, they are more vigilant.”

Ladoja opined that he would win the Oyo Governorship poll.
